Anesthesiologists are crucial members of the medical field, responsible for administering anesthesia to patients undergoing surgeries or other medical procedures, and monitoring their vital signs to ensure their safety. Their duties include designing and implementing anesthesia plans, managing and treating changes in a patient's critical life functions - heart rate, body temperature, blood pressure, and breathing - as they are affected by the surgery being performed. They also work closely with other doctors to coordinate patient care during the preoperative, intraoperative, and postoperative stages.

To be a successful Anesthesiologist, one needs to have a combination of advanced medical knowledge, technical expertise, and interpersonal skills. They should have a Medical Doctor (MD) or Doctor of Osteopathic Medicine (DO) degree, and complete an accredited Anesthesiology residency program. They also need to obtain board certification from the American Board of Anesthesiology or the American Osteopathic Board of Anesthesiology. Prior to becoming an Anesthesiologist, an individual may have roles such as a Medical Intern, Resident Physician, or Anesthesiology Fellow where they gain hands-on experience in patient care and medical procedures.
